Giorgia Moll (born January 14, 1938 in Prata di Pordenone ) is an Italian actress and singer who was successful in the 1950s and 1960s. Later she worked as a photographer .

Life

At the age of 17 she was discovered in 1955 for Non scherzare con le donne before she starred in many films in the 50s and 60s, including Four Pipes of Opium by Joseph L. Mankiewicz and The Contempt by Jean-Luc Godard . In addition, she worked as a singer in the 1960s and recorded several records. After 1970 she ended her career as an actress. In her time she was a sought-after pin-up girl and had herself photographed for the Italian playmen in 1972 .
